"Rara" is a word in HILIGAYNON
rára - (B) Wicker work, basket-weaving; to
make wicker work, weave baskets. Raráha
iníng baníg. Weave this mat. Raráhi akó
sing kálò. Weave a hat for me. Maálam ka
magrára? Do you know how to weave
baskets? (cf. lála).
